IRS announces first day of 2026 filing season

January 9, 2026

The IRS recently announced that the 2026 filing season for individual tax returns will start on Monday, Jan. 26.

Several new tax law provisions of H.R. 1 — commonly known as the One Big Beautiful Bill Act — will take effect this year, which could impact federal taxes, credits and deductions.

Taxpayers have until Wednesday, April 15, to file their 2025 tax returns and pay any tax due.

The IRS expects to receive about 164 million individual income tax returns this year, with most taxpayers filing electronically.

The IRS’s One, Big, Beautiful Provisions webpage provides more information that could help lower tax bills and potentially increase refund amounts.
